Course Details

• Understanding Human Smuggling: Definitions, Trends, and Dynamics
• Legal Frameworks and International Cooperation to Combat Human Smuggling
• The Organizational Structure and Modus Operandi of Criminal Networks
• The Role of Technology in Human Smuggling and its Implications for Law Enforcement
• Investigative Techniques and Criminal Intelligence Gathering
• Multi-Agency Collaboration and Information Sharing in Combating Human Smuggling
• Victim-Centered Approaches and Support Services
• Prevention Strategies and Public Awareness Campaigns
• Policy Analysis and Advocacy for Effective Human Smuggling Legislation
• Ethical Considerations and Human Rights Protection in Combating Human Smuggling
